Remember your quilt will not qualify if it has been shown anywhere else here on the board or online.
Here are the directions:
To Enter:
send the following by email to: [email protected]
1. Your Board name
2. One clear photo that shows the whole front.
3. One clear photo that shows the whole back.
4. Four clear closeup photos that show the details you want highlighted
from different sections of the front. (four different sections)
if you didn't design it yourself, please give credit to the designer
and tell us the pattern name.
5. if somebody else did the quilting for you, please giver her/him credit as
well.
(please note: check the copyright restrictions carefully if you are using a commercial pattern you didn't publish yourself. The Quilting Board will not assume any liability if an entrant violates restrictions.
Responsibility, accountability, and liability for any violations of copyright law will fall exclusively and entirely upon the entrant. We will also have no choice but to disqualify and delete any entries challenged by the rightful owner of the copyright.)
If you are wanting to learn to add pictures you can usually in most places scroll down and find manage attachments. Click on that and you will have a window pop up. In that window you will see browse.click on that and find your picture. Make sure it is sized right and the right file type. Then click on the open in the window and it will add your pic to the first window. Then click on update. Then close the window. Your pic will be attached to your post and all you need to do now is submit.
If you don't see manage attachments then click on the little picture frame with a tree in the middle in your tool bar above your post window. Then you should see From computer / Url Click on From Computer. then browse and find your pic. Click on open in that window and it will add your pic. Then click on update and your pic will be added to your post.
